What are the realities of your family’s financial situation. Some parents who can afford fairly high tuition without it impacting on the parents’ or family’s quality of life or financial security never-the-less decide that a free or very low cost option makes more sense. Some parents really struggle to afford even to keep the electricity flowing. They simply don’t have any discretionary funds at all. The upshot may be the same-that is, they want their son/daughter to go for the least expensive option possible-but the differing financial situation of the families would impact on the advice I’d give to the student wanting a different school. Where do you view your parents on this sort of continuum?
